History

Assigned USN penant DE 568 but not named.

Returned to the USN on 11 June 1946. Scrapped.

Commanding Officers:
Lt. Clement Francis Parker, RN
18 January 1944 – September 1945
Promoted to Lt.Cdr. on 5 January 1945

Lt. Charles Gordon Walker, RN
September 1945 – still in command in October 1945 according to the Navy List
